###Track Record and Reputation
Let’s start with the easiest way to suss out a supplier: look at their track record. You know, the old "actions speak louder than words" thing. A supplier with a solid history of delivering quality equipment over the years is more likely to be reliable. You can check out industry forums, review sites, and even ask for references directly from the supplier.
I mean, think about it. If a supplier has been around for a long time, say 10, 20 years, they’ve probably dealt with all sorts of challenges. They’ve learned from their mistakes and have refined their processes. That’s gold in terms of reliability. A newbie might be full of energy and new ideas, but they lack that real – world experience.
Another thing to look at is their reputation in the industry. Are they known for cutting corners or for going the extra mile? You can talk to other businesses in your field who’ve used their equipment. Word – of – mouth is still one of the most powerful ways to gauge a supplier’s reliability. If everyone’s raving about a supplier, chances are they’re doing something right.
###Product Quality
The quality of the conveying equipment is, of course, a huge factor. You don’t want to end up with something that breaks down after a few months of use. A reliable supplier will use high – quality materials and have strict manufacturing standards.
When you’re evaluating a supplier, ask about the materials they use. For example, if it’s a conveyor belt, what kind of rubber or fabric is it made of? Is it resistant to wear and tear, chemicals, or extreme temperatures? A good supplier will be able to give you detailed information about the materials and why they’re chosen.
Also, look at the manufacturing process. Do they have quality control checks at every stage? Are their factories up – to – date with the latest technology? In my own experience, investing in the latest manufacturing equipment can really improve the quality of the final product.
You can also ask for product samples or visit the supplier’s factory if possible. Seeing the equipment in person gives you a much better idea of its quality. You can check for things like smooth operation, proper alignment, and overall build quality.
###Technical Support and After – Sales Service
Let’s face it, no matter how good the equipment is, there might be issues down the line. That’s where a reliable supplier’s technical support and after – sales service come in.
A good supplier will have a team of experts who can answer your questions quickly. Whether it’s a simple installation query or a complex troubleshooting issue, they should be there for you. You can test their responsiveness by sending them a few questions before you make a purchase. How long do they take to get back to you? Do they give clear and useful answers?
After – sales service is also super important. If something goes wrong with the equipment, will they come and fix it? Do they offer warranties? A reliable supplier will stand behind their product and make sure you’re satisfied. ###Customization Capabilities
Every business has its own unique needs when it comes to conveying equipment. A reliable supplier should be able to offer customization options.
If you have a specific layout in your factory or a particular type of product to convey, the supplier should be able to design and build equipment that meets your requirements. This shows that they’re flexible and willing to work with you to find the best solution.
When you’re talking to a supplier, ask about their customization process. How long does it take? What’s the cost involved? A good supplier will work with you to create a realistic plan that fits your budget and timeline.
###Compliance and Certifications
In the conveying equipment industry, there are a lot of regulations and standards that suppliers need to comply with. A reliable supplier will have all the necessary certifications.
For example, in some countries, there are safety standards for conveyor belts to prevent accidents. Make sure the supplier’s equipment meets these standards. You can ask to see their certification documents, and if they’re hesitant to provide them, that’s a red flag.
Certifications also show that the supplier is committed to quality and safety. It’s like a stamp of approval from an independent organization.
###Pricing and Payment Terms
Price is always a factor when you’re buying equipment. However, the cheapest option isn’t always the best. A reliable supplier will offer a fair price for the quality of the equipment.
Compare prices from different suppliers, but don’t just look at the upfront cost. Consider the long – term costs, such as maintenance, repairs, and energy consumption. A high – quality piece of equipment might cost more initially, but it could save you money in the long run.
Also, look at the payment terms. Are they flexible? Do they offer financing options? Some suppliers might require a large upfront payment, while others might be more willing to work out a payment schedule that suits your business.
###Supply Chain Management
The supplier’s supply chain management can also impact their reliability. A well – managed supply chain means they can get the materials they need to build your equipment on time.
If a supplier is constantly running into supply shortages, it could lead to delays in delivering your equipment. You can ask them about their inventory management system and how they handle potential supply chain disruptions. For example, do they have multiple suppliers for critical components?
By looking into their supply chain management, you can get an idea of how likely they are to meet your delivery deadlines.
###Communication and Transparency
Good communication is key in any business relationship. A reliable supplier will keep you informed throughout the process, from the initial quote to the final delivery.
They should be transparent about any potential issues or delays. If there’s a problem with the manufacturing process or a delay in getting materials, they should let you know as soon as possible. This shows that they respect your time and are committed to keeping their promises.
